When should a Nutrition Coach refer a client to an Obstetrician?

A Nutrition Coach should refer a client to an Obstetrician when the client is postpartum and wants to lose weight. This period comes with unique physiological changes and health considerations that necessitate professional medical guidance. Postpartum individuals may face various complications or health issues related to childbirth that could impact their ability to safely lose weight or engage in certain dietary practices. An Obstetrician can offer expert insight tailored to the client's medical history, recovery status, and overall health, ensuring that any weight loss plan is safe and effective.

In contrast, digestive concerns can often be managed through nutrition plans and lifestyle changes, anxiety might be better addressed by a mental health professional, and training for a marathon typically falls within the scope of a nutrition coach's expertise, focusing on performance nutrition rather than medical intervention.
